18 U.S. Christian Colleges Forced to Shut Down; Due to COVID Pandemic and Financial Difficulties

 A new study shows that 18 Christian colleges have closed or merged since the beginning of the COVID pandemic in 2020, the Christianity Today website reports today (April 28, 2023).


The study was conducted by Higher Ed Drive, which is tracking "major closings, mergers, acquisitions, and other consolidation among public and private nonprofit institutions from 2016 to the present."


The study found that the 18 Christian colleges that closed were Methodist, Lutheran, Roman Catholic, Baptist, Church of Christ,  and Independent Christian Church schools. The schools were all small and had faced financial difficulties even before the COVID pandemic.
